Travel with Peace of Mind with Flexible Bookings

What I love about booking the Super Seat Fest 9.9 Sale of Cebu Pacific is the flexible booking options. Guests are allowed to choose from unlimited rebooking or 2-Year Travel Fund whenever changes to future travels will arise. As I’m ready to fly again, I used my travel fund (cost of previously booked flights converted into an e-wallet to pay for future bookings).
